Semaglutide vs Liraglutide for Weight Loss

While both semaglutide and liraglutide are GLP-1 receptor agonists approved for chronic weight management, their pharmacokinetic differences produce substantially divergent weight loss outcomes. Semaglutide 2.4 mg weekly achieves approximately 15% body weight reduction — nearly double the 8% achieved by liraglutide 3.0 mg daily — driven by higher sustained receptor occupancy, more potent central appetite suppression, and superior patient adherence to once-weekly dosing.

Structural Basis for Weight Loss Differences

Liraglutide for obesity is dosed at 3.0 mg daily (vs. 1.8 mg for diabetes). The C-16 palmitoyl fatty acyl chain promotes albumin binding and self-association at injection sites, extending the half-life to approximately 13 hours. The molecule retains native GLP-1 sequence identity at the DPP-4 cleavage site (position 8), limiting enzymatic stability.

Semaglutide for obesity is dosed at 2.4 mg weekly (vs. 1.0 mg for diabetes). Three key structural differences from liraglutide enhance weight loss efficacy:

  1. Aib at position 8: α-Aminoisobutyric acid substitution blocks DPP-4 cleavage, extending the half-life to approximately 165 hours
  2. C-18 fatty diacid at Lys26: Stronger albumin binding than liraglutide’s C-16 palmitoyl chain
  3. Mini-PEG linker: Further increases hydrodynamic radius and renal filtration resistance

The combination of extended half-life and higher sustained plasma concentrations produces greater GLP-1R occupancy at hypothalamic appetite centers, translating to more potent and sustained appetite suppression.

Both agents produce weight loss that is approximately 60–70% fat mass and 30–40% lean mass — a ratio similar to diet-induced weight loss. Adjunctive resistance training can mitigate lean mass loss with both agents.

GI side effects are the primary reason for discontinuation with both agents. However, the weekly dosing schedule of semaglutide allows more gradual adaptation, and the absence of daily injections may improve perceived tolerability.

The SELECT trial established semaglutide 2.4 mg as the first anti-obesity medication to demonstrate cardiovascular mortality reduction, strengthening its position as the preferred agent for patients with obesity and cardiovascular disease risk.
